AI语音SDK在语音识别中的错误纠正方法
在我国,随着人工智能技术的飞速发展,AI语音识别技术已经广泛应用于各个领域,如智能客服、智能家居、语音助手等。然而,在实际应用过程中,AI语音识别系统仍然存在着一定的错误率。为了提高语音识别的准确性,降低错误率,AI语音SDK在语音识别中的错误纠正方法成为研究的热点。本文将讲述一个AI语音SDK在语音识别错误纠正中的应用案例,以期为大家提供一些启示。
故事的主人公名叫李明,是一名软件开发工程师。他在一家互联网公司工作,负责开发一款智能语音助手产品。该产品旨在为用户提供便捷的语音交互体验,实现语音识别、语音合成、语音翻译等功能。然而,在产品开发过程中,李明发现语音识别系统存在较高的错误率,严重影响了用户体验。
为了提高语音识别的准确性,降低错误率,李明决定从AI语音SDK的层面入手,对语音识别系统进行优化。以下是他所采取的几个步骤:
一、数据分析
首先,李明对语音识别系统进行了全面的数据分析,包括识别错误类型、错误频率、错误原因等。通过分析,他发现以下问题:
- 误识别:由于语音信号复杂,系统有时会将相似音素误识别为其他音素;
- 漏识别:在连续语音中,系统有时会遗漏部分语音;
- 误标点:在语音转文字过程中,系统有时会将标点符号误识别为其他字符。
二、错误纠正策略
针对上述问题,李明设计了以下错误纠正策略:
音素识别优化:通过引入更多的音素,提高音素识别的准确性。例如,在汉语普通话中,增加儿化音、轻声等音素的识别能力。
连续语音识别优化:采用动态时间规整(DTW)算法,对连续语音进行时间归一化处理,降低漏识别现象。
误标点纠正:在语音转文字过程中,引入自然语言处理(NLP)技术,对误识别的标点符号进行修正。
三、算法改进
为了提高语音识别的准确性,李明在原有算法的基础上进行了以下改进:
引入深度学习技术:采用深度神经网络(DNN)对语音信号进行特征提取,提高语音识别的准确性。
融合多种语音模型:结合隐马尔可夫模型(HMM)和深度学习模型,提高语音识别的鲁棒性。
优化解码器:采用基于梯度的解码器(GMM-HMM),提高解码速度和准确性。
四、实际应用效果
经过优化,李明的语音助手产品在语音识别准确率方面有了显著提升。以下是优化前后的一些数据对比:
- 误识别率从5%降至2%;
- 漏识别率从3%降至1%;
- 误标点率从2%降至0.5%。
通过李明的努力,这款语音助手产品获得了良好的市场口碑,为用户提供了一个更加便捷、准确的语音交互体验。
总结
本文以李明的案例为例,阐述了AI语音SDK在语音识别错误纠正中的应用方法。通过对语音识别系统进行数据分析、错误纠正策略设计、算法改进等步骤,可以有效提高语音识别的准确性,降低错误率。在人工智能技术不断发展的今天,AI语音SDK在语音识别领域的应用前景十分广阔。
猜你喜欢:AI聊天软件